Silicon arrayed‐waveguide grating using rib‐waveguide multimode interference coupler at the array and slab waveguide interface is reported. A 100 GHz channel spacing 8ch device showing 2.8 dB insertion loss is obtained. The insertion loss was improved compared with a device using simple width taper.
